After a discussion about the structures of hydrides of group-15 elements, .Neethu wrote the order of bond angles as `NH_3ltPH_3ltAsH_3`. Justify ‘your answer:

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The bond angle decreases from `NH_3`to `BiH_3`,i.e., the correct order of bond’ angle is `NH_3gtPH_3gtAsH_3`.As the size of the central atom in the hydride increases, its electronegativity. decreases, Consequently the position of the bond pair of electrons tend to lie away from the central atom in moving from `NH_3` to `AsH_3` As a result the repulsion between bond pair of electrons' ' decreases and the bond angle decreases.
